Solve for x.
5(x - 2) – x – 5 = -3

Answer:

x=3

Step-by-step explanation:

Step 1: Simplify both sides of the equation.

5(x−2)−x−5=−3

(5)(x)+(5)(−2)+−x+−5=−3(Distribute)

5x+−10+−x+−5=−3

(5x+−x)+(−10+−5)=−3(Combine Like Terms)

4x+−15=−3

4x−15=−3

Step 2: Add 15 to both sides.

4x−15+15=−3+15

4x=12

Step 3: Divide both sides by 4.

[tex]\frac{4x}{4} =\frac{12}{4}[/tex]

x=3
